For the 2025 school year, there are 2 public middle schools serving 1,725 students in 15317, PA.
The top ranked public middle schools in 15317, PA are Peters Twp Middle School and Canon-mcmillan Middle School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Public middle schools in zipcode 15317 have an average math proficiency score of 54% (versus the Pennsylvania public middle school average of 26%), and reading proficiency score of 81% (versus the 52% statewide average). Middle schools in 15317, PA have an average ranking of 10/10, which is in the top 5% of Pennsylvania public middle schools.
Minority enrollment is 11% of the student body (majority Asian and Hispanic), which is less than the Pennsylvania public middle school average of 46% (majority Black and Hispanic).
